In 77609 Days 3 Hours, there will be 271,631,937,500,001 searches made on Google!
Over 3.5 billion Google searches per day
In 77609 Days 3 Hours, you could run 20,116,285,200 miles!
Average runner = 12 minute mile
In 77609 Days 3 Hours, 30,618,394,520,548 trees will be cut down!
3 billion to 6 billion trees per year
In 77609 Days 3 Hours, there will be 15,909,870,625,000,000 Emails sent around the world!
Over 205 billion emails sent per day